Spotting a Fake Broker: Red Flags to Watch For
Protecting your investments requires vigilance, and that includes recognizing fraudulent brokerages. Several warning signs should immediately raise your concern. Be alert of brokers who pressure you into urgent decisions, promise assured returns – a blatant lie in the investment world – or decline to provide written documentation, such as regulatory licenses. Also, be conscious of brokers operating from unclear locations or communicating only through risky channels like instant messaging. Finally, always verify a brokerage's licensing with relevant regulatory authorities like the SEC or FINRA before entrusting them with your assets.
- Unsolicited Offers: Be skeptical of surprise investment opportunities.
- High-Pressure Tactics: Avoid those pushing for rapid decisions.
- Lack of Transparency: Investigate brokers who are unwilling to thoroughly explain their costs.
- Unregistered Status: Check that the brokerage is properly authorized.

Avoid Being a Prey: Financial Scam Alert Signs
Protecting your money from deceptive investment schemes requires vigilance . Be wary of pitches that guarantee huge returns with little effort. Con artists often employ sophisticated tactics to attract unsuspecting investors . Here are some crucial warning signs to watch out for:
- Unexpected Offers : Be doubtful of lucrative opportunities that arrive uninvited .
- Urgent Tactics: Dishonest brokers often push you to act quickly before you have time to investigate properly.
- Unverified Representatives : Verify that the person offering the deal is properly registered with the governing authorities.
- Opaque Plans: When something sounds too complicated , it probably is. Legitimate investments are typically straightforward to understand.
- Guaranteed Returns: Recognize that all investments carry a degree of risk. Promises of significant returns are a significant red flag.
Always undertake thorough investigation and consult a qualified financial advisor before making any financial .
Forex & Broker Scams: How to Safeguard Yourself
The appealing world of Forex trading can unfortunately also be a breeding ground for fraudulent schemes and unscrupulous brokers. Becoming a target to these scams is a serious risk, but understanding the red flags and taking preventative actions can greatly reduce your chance. Be extremely cautious of unexpected offers, promised profits (which are impossible in Forex), and remarkably generous leverage. Always carefully investigate any potential broker before transferring funds. Ensure their regulation with a recognized regulatory body – such as the FCA, CySEC, or ASIC. Remember to never put more than you can spare.
- Validate broker authorization status.
- Steer clear of excessive profit claims.
- Look for clear fee pricing.
- Refrain from accepting suspicious emails or attachments.
- Educate yourself about the markets and common scams.
